I have the guts to try and throw flips now but i just cant seem to figure out how to rotate. Everyone tells me its easy to do the back roll how its kind of like a gainer, but I can't seem to feel how to get the rotation in. Ive tried fronts off my toeside too, I get the closest with those but i dont get much air. HELP PLEASE!! _________________ yeah Crownsville Air Force! |

The most important thing is how you come off the wake. You have to have a good release to have any chance to land anything, so make sure you know what the motions are. Check out the trick tips on this site, visualize what it takes to do the edge, release, rotation, landing, etc.. and just give it a go.
Here is a solid heelside backroll, good progressive edge, good kick off the wake..

Is a Gainer when you leave the diving board kick the feet up in front of you, look over the back and dive head first into the pool that way? if so the Tantrum is like a gainer not the HS backroll..
TS front- I guarantee you are tryn' to tuck and flip too early, dive out across the wake a bit more before you tuck and flip forward.
Jim is right that clip is a SOLID backroll, with lots o speed to land in the flats... I take mine W2W still, I'm lame like that... _________________ PEACE
